]]>Prepare two different types of protein for the week—it doesn’t have to be chicken and fish or meat and fish, it can be as simple as chicken cooked two different ways with two different sauces. You’ll want some variety when meal planning, so prepare some breasts for Monday, Wednesday, and Friday and some thighs and legs for Tuesday and Thursday. The same goes for whole grains—you won’t want rice every night, so mix it up with some whole-grain pasta, quinoa, bulgar, or millet. These will last in the fridge for five days.
Cut up your vegetables for the week. What puts most people off is the constant chopping before each meal which takes longer than eating. So while your whole grains and proteins are cooking, start chopping. Keep them all in sealed containers in the fridge so you can just throw them in a salad or the oven when you come home from a busy day.
Make overnight oats for breakfast. This is a one-and-done prep that can last five mornings and is so filling and delicious that you won’t even need to think about what to eat. And you can add anything you want on top. All you need is a bag of oats and some yogurts—we suggest the high-protein ones. Then add your milk of choice, chia seeds (if you want), and maple syrup or honey. You will have a meal filled with all the nutrients you need. You can make it in a large bowl or put it in individual mason jars.

]]>One of the best tricks is to portion it, Grab several freezer bags and fill them with soup. This way you are making things much easier. You are meal-prepping at the same time.
When you first put the bags in the freezer, they should be in a single layer. Once they are frozen, you can stack them up.
https://www.instagram.com/p/BoUoNflFiKf/
If you are planning to freeze soup, forget about adding herbs or nuts. When frozen they easily change their taste and will alter your experience with the soup. The good thing is you can add as many as you like when you reheat.
Dairy products are also very risky. The best idea is not to include them at all, even if the recipe says so. Since you will be reheating the soup eventually, that is when you add everything dairy.

]]>The fastest and easiest way to peel garlic is simple and you only need a mason jar! Simply put a head of garlic in the jar with the lid on, shake vigorously, and all the skins will fall off!
https://www.instagram.com/p/BgoXawJjCHK/?tagged=masonjar
One of the biggest problems people have with garlic is all the peeling and chopping involved. But, you can have garlic whenever you want without having to pull out your cutting board every time. Simply peel a head of garlic, pop the cloves in a food processor with some olive oil, put in ice cube traces and you’re done! Seal in a plastic bag and use a cube of garlic whenever necessary.
https://www.instagram.com/p/BPgswgfguO6/?tagged=frozengarlic
Roasted garlic is great to add to dips, or simply spread on bread. Cut off the top of a head of garlic, drizzle olive oil over it, stick it in the oven, and once it’s done, the cloves can be squeezed out of the head. No peeling or fuss!

Beef is always a popular ingredient for kids, and when you can get some Mexican flavors into the meal, you’re likely to have a hit on your hands.
All you’ve got to do is cook a pound of ground beef and mix it with a 16-ounce jar of black bean or corn salsa, 1/4 cup of enchilada sauce and a cup of Mexican cheese. Spoon the mixture into eight flour tortillas and top with the rest of the 10-ounce can of enchilada sauce and another cup of cheese, then bake at 350 degrees for 45 minutes and you’ll not only have dinner, but you’ll have lunch for the next day.
Don’t forget the sour cream!
https://www.instagram.com/p/BbIZTY3lnIi/?tagged=beefenchiladacasserole
Tater tots are another very popular food item, and this dish allows you to get some other good stuff in there.
A pound of cooked ground beef mixed with a cup of nacho cheese forms the base in a skillet, and when you cover it with 3/4 cup of frozen peas, a cup of shredded cheese and a 16-ounce bag of tater tots, you’ve got all you need for a great meal.
Just bake 25 minutes in an ovenproof skillet at 425 degrees and you’re good to go!
Adam Carolla once said there’s nothing you can put in ravioli that’s bad. That might not be quite true, but you can have a lot of fun with this.
Cook two 9 oz. packages of ravioli according to directions and drain them, making sure they’re cooked al dente and ready for sauce. While draining, mix a jar of your favorite pasta sauce with a teaspoon of dried basil and heat for five minutes. Stir in the ravioli and place in a 9 x 13 pan, then top with two cups of mozzarella. Bake 10 minutes at 400 degrees and it’s an Italian feast!
